    <![CDATA[<strong>Author:</strong> <a href="https://forum.asrock.com/member_profile.asp?PF=10173">Boko346</a><br /><strong>Subject:</strong> 9069<br /><strong>Posted:</strong> 03 Jul 2018 at 5:02pm<br /><br /><a href="" target="_blank" rel="nofollow"></a>I have an Asrock x99 Extreme6 motherboard with 2x8GB memory modules. These were bought in a pair and have the exact same stats. I used to have them in dual channel mode with them plugged into A1 and A2. I was not the one who configured this. However, I recently learned that any module plugged into A1 would cause the computer to crash on almost random occasions. More than likely a problem with the board. However, the manual both online and in my hands says I should be putting the memory modules into A1, B1, C1 and D1 to get dual memory mode. I've tried every combonation I can think of without plugging memory into A1 and none seem to get me my required status of 'dual memory' mode on CPU-Z. Can someone explain to me how I might be able to get my machine back into dual memory mode without using A1?]]>
